Mercurial > hg > Members > masakoha > masa
comparison 14/February/memo/MMAPvsDivideRead.txt @ 51:d8f499590d82
rename 201* to 1*
author | Masataka Kohagura <e085726@ie.u-ryukyu.ac.jp> |
---|---|
date | Sun, 16 Mar 2014 13:36:04 +0900 |
parents | 2014/February/memo/MMAPvsDivideRead.txt@fe3ef7f6a23f |
children |
comparison
equal
deleted
inserted
replaced
50:43c6da29d688 | 51:d8f499590d82 |
---|---|
1 [program] | |
2 | |
3 mmap だと ramdam access なので DB だと使用されない -> read を使用している。 | |
4 | |
5 実験環境をいろいろ変えてみよう | |
6 OSを変更してみる。(Linux など) | |
7 mmap の flag をかえてみる | |
8 priority 下げてみる?? | |
9 様々なことをやってみよう | |
10 | |
11 [実験環境] | |
12 firefly で計測 | |
13 mac os X 10.9.1 | |
14 2*2.66 GHz, HHD 1TB, memory 16GB | |
15 読み込んだ file size : 10740996168 Byte (10GB) | |
16 | |
17 読み込んでから Task が終了するまでの時間を測定 | |
18 | |
19 % ./regex -file 10gb.txt -sw doing -division 128 -block 48 -cpu 12 -br | |
20 [結果] | |
21 bm_search one task size 128k | |
22 task blocks 48 | |
23 CPUNUM | |
24 1 | |
25 MMAP | |
26 second 35.713130 | |
27 IO BRead | |
28 2 | |
29 MMAP 94.298429 94.268424 96.484658 | |
30 second 17.186720 | |
31 IO BRead 100.222430 100.458053 94.847105 | |
32 3 | |
33 MMAP 129.450665 108.940161 106.512558 | |
34 second 12.161487 | |
35 SPE BRead 107.156623 | |
36 IO BRead 96.690044 98.422669 95.189016 | |
37 4 | |
38 MMAP 135.155317 142.751540 148.916697 137.110170 147.350221 | |
39 second 12.102094 | |
40 SPE BRead 96.664415 | |
41 IO BRead 109.181394 97.955774 94.676133 94.508641 97.399619 | |
42 8 | |
43 MMAP 174.250825 146.720434 147.433098 | |
44 second 6.942862 | |
45 IO BRead 90.398165 91.338648 101.322919 | |
46 12 | |
47 MMAP 181.776079 148.274648 148.439857 147.485801 147.036413 | |
48 second 6.929711 | |
49 SPE BRead 111.674880 94.806148 106.796695 106.796695 95.730738 | |
50 IO BRead 95.656162 117.457584 96.305392 91.637826 94.680580 | |
51 | |
52 bm_search one task size 64k | |
53 task blocks 48 | |
54 12 | |
55 MMAP 128.752630 130.268836 | |
56 IO BRead 97.779679 109.356311 | |
57 | |
58 bm_search one task size 256k | |
59 task blocks 48 | |
60 12 | |
61 MMAP 166.577149 148.437492 | |
62 IO BRead 107.571059 99.907239 | |
63 | |
64 bm_search one task size 512k | |
65 task blocks 48 | |
66 12 | |
67 MMAP 149.994577 138.402043 | |
68 IO BRead 94.069890 101.792784 | |
69 | |
70 bm_search one task size 128k | |
71 task blocks 24 | |
72 12 | |
73 MMAP 153.115449 | |
74 IO BRead 98.620145 | |
75 | |
76 bm_search one task size 128k | |
77 task blocks 64 | |
78 12 | |
79 MMAP 153.186823 | |
80 IO BRead 95.646812 | |
81 | |
82 bm_search one task size 256k | |
83 task blocks 64 | |
84 12 | |
85 MMAP 147.430725 | |
86 IO BRead 94.544596 | |
87 | |
88 bm_search one task size 256k | |
89 task blocks 256 | |
90 12 | |
91 MMAP 150.335210 | |
92 IO BRead 111.773256 | |
93 | |
94 fileread | |
95 file read one task size | |
96 1024 * 128 * 48 cpu 1 93.605574 95.171400 | |
97 1024 * 128 * 48 cpu 4 97.775177 97.714276 | |
98 1024 * 256 * 256 cpu 4 98.261143 95.614298 |